1 :: How to drill through from a powerplay cube to reportnet?

Setting up drill-through access from PowerPlay Web to ReportNet involves

1. configuring Cognos Series 7 for drill-through access to ReportNet
2. preparing the Transformer model and cube
3. copying the search path of the folder that contains the target report
4. enabling the cube for drill-through access to ReportNet
5. deciding which filters to create in the target report
6. creating the target report
7. disabling the Drill Through Assistant

3 :: Explain What is difference between query studio and report studio?

Query Studio:

1. Used to create Ad-hoc (or) simple reports.

2. It does not provide any pre-defined report templates.

3. It directly displays data (without running the report) when we insert attributes in the report.

Report Studio:

1. Used to create complex reports.

2. It provides pre-defined report templates.

3. It does not display the data directly in the report. We need to run the report to display the data.

7 :: How to generate the cubes in framework manager?

You can create the IQD file from framework manager.

This IQD file will be used by Transformer to create the cube.

Use Externalize method to import IQD files.

8 :: Explain How to generate IQD file from framework manager?

Create a Query Subject, from the properties pane select externalise,there we have 4 options in that select IQD
